    Winter Jasmine is a cheerful, early-blooming shrub that brightens the landscape when little else is in flower. Producing masses of bright yellow blooms along its arching green stems in late winter to early spring, it brings a welcome burst of color before most plants awaken. Unlike many jasmines, it is not strongly fragrant, but it makes up for it with its reliable blooms and versatility. It can be grown as a sprawling groundcover, cascading over walls, or trained along trellises for a more structured look.

    Key Features

    • Growth Habit:
      • Arching, spreading shrub or vine-like groundcover
      • Typically grows 3–5 feet tall and 4–7 feet wide
      • Can be trained on supports or allowed to sprawl naturally
    • Bloom Color:
      • Bright yellow flowers appearing on bare stems
    • Fragrance:
      • Little to no fragrance
    • Wildlife Attraction & Pest Resistance:
      • Provides early-season interest for pollinators
      • Deer resistant
      • Generally pest and disease resistant
    • Planting Zones: USDA Zones 6–10
    • Sun Preferences: Full sun to partial shade (best flowering in full sun)
    • Drought Tolerance: Moderate once established; prefers occasional deep watering

    Planting Instructions (From a 3.5" Pot into the Ground)

    1. Choose the Location

    • Select a sunny or lightly shaded area.
    • Ideal for slopes, retaining walls, borders, or trellises.

    2. Prepare the Soil

    • Loosen soil 8–10 inches deep.
    • Add compost to improve drainage and fertility.

    3. Dig the Hole

    • Dig a hole twice as wide as the 3.5" pot and equal depth.

    4. Remove from Pot

    • Gently remove the plant and loosen any circling roots.

    5. Plant

    • Place the plant so the root ball is level with the soil surface.
    • Backfill and firm soil gently.

    6. Water

    • Water thoroughly after planting.
    • Keep soil evenly moist during establishment.

    7. Spacing

    • Space plants 4–6 feet apart depending on spread.

    Overwintering Winter Jasmine

    In-Ground (Zones 6–10)

    • Fully cold hardy and blooms in late winter
    • Requires minimal winter care
    • Apply a light mulch layer to protect roots in colder regions

    Maintenance Tips

    • Prune after flowering to shape and control size
    • Older stems can be thinned to encourage new growth

    Container Plants

    • Move to a sheltered location during extreme cold
    • Water occasionally to prevent soil from completely drying out

    Winter Jasmine is a dependable, low-maintenance shrub that provides early color and versatility in the landscape. Its ability to bloom during the coldest months makes it a valuable addition to gardens seeking year-round interest.
